· CONVENIENT: The Renewed Premium Explorian Blender with programs has 3 settings for Smoothies, Hot Soups and Frozen Desserts to ensure walk-away convenience and consistent results · YOU'RE IN CONTROL: Variable Speed Control and Pulse feature let you manually fine-tune the texture of any recipe · 64-OUNCE CONTAINER: The 64-ounce Low-Profile blending container allows for large capacity blends while still fitting under kitchen cabinets · DURABLE: The powerful 2.2 HP motor can handle even tough ingredients to create high-quality blends · SELF CLEANING: With a drop of dish soap and warm water, your Vitamix machine can clean itself in 30 to 60 seconds—no disassembly required

I've never been more disappointed in a product. After years of hearing about how great the Vitamix is, I decided to invest in one. I was really looking forward to those thick acai bowls! I was coming from a nutribullet pro that I have used for the last few years to make acai bowls with frozen blocks. It required some coaxing but did the trick. This Vitamix requires a SIGNIFICANT amount of coaxing to get the acai bowls to blend and I wind up with a halfway melted base of acai every time. It seriously can only "try" to blend for about 4 seconds before getting stuck and I have to rework the product with the stick or by taking off and stirring product. I am adding enough liquid - it just does not meet the hype it terms of power. It SUCKS. I know I did not buy the more expensive one, but this one does not even do what my nutribullet pro was capable of at a much lower price point. This is a frustrating piece of equipment and it makes me angry I spend the extra money on it every time I use it. I am not one to write negative reviews but this warranted it. Truly regret buying this product.

I feel like I got a good deal on this at around $240. It's not too loud or too complicated to use. Blending power is great coming from a little Ninja blender I got for $40 a couple years back. The Ninja was probably a third of this one's size and was way louder and leaked all the time. I hated that thing so much I stopped using it after a month. My only gripe: they tell you not to put the lid or the jar into the dishwasher, but their recommended cleaning method of putting some soap and warm water and running the blender doesn't seem to clean the top area that well and does absolutely nothing for the rim/spout which get messy pretty regularly. The lid gets stuff caked inside of it really easily as well. So, expect to do a little bit of manual cleaning if you decide not to be a rebel and just put it in the dishwasher anyway. There are a lot of people on Reddit who mentioned they just put it in the dishwasher anyway and haven't really had any problems, but YMMV.
